To delete individual messages: 1. Open Gmail. 2. Open the message (or select the checkbox next to it). 3. Click the Trash icon. 4. To delete a specific message from a conversation thread, click the down arrow next to Reply and choose Delete this message. To delete many or all messages at once: 1. Open Gmail. 2. Find the group of messages you want to delete. You can find messages by searching or by selecting all messages with a certain label. 3. Select messages using the checkbox in the toolbar above your messages. This selects all messages that are currently visible on the page. 4. Directly above your messages, you should see a sentence similar to this: 5. "All 20 conversations on this page are selected. Select all conversations that match this search." Use the "Select all conversations" link to select the rest of the messages if you'd like to delete all the messages at once rather than one page at a time. 6. If you're confident you won't need these messages in the future, click the Trash icon. To permanently delete messages manually: 1. If you want to permanently delete a message right away, you can do it manually. 2. Go to Trash (see directions above). 3. To delete messages individually, open or select the message and click the Delete forever. 4. To delete all messages in Trash at once, click the Empty Trash now link directly above the messages.
